|
|
|
|
|
|
|
|
|
r34928
| file changeset diff or repo changeset diff
| igor2 | 2021-06-17T03:05:22.921960Z
| [route_style] -Add: remember last route style selected [route_style] -Fix: use the 'last route style selected' cache to get the right style selected when when multiple route styles match
|
|
r34924
| file changeset diff or repo changeset diff
| igor2 | 2021-06-16T14:15:20.820856Z
| [core] -Fix: Display(RealignGrid): do not force a new click; when invoked by hotkey or action, just use the current position of the crosshair; this allows the user to take advantage of a coarse grid and object snap
|
|
|
|
|
|
|
|
|
|
r34486
| file changeset diff or repo changeset diff
| igor2 | 2021-04-14T11:22:46.384370Z
| [core] -Cleanup: move undo serial management out from low level ApplyPen call so operation on selected will be a single undo serial
|
|
|
|
|
|
r34438
| file changeset diff or repo changeset diff
| igor2 | 2021-04-12T13:22:20.698402Z
| [core] -Cleanup: RouteStyle() action uses the central route-style-to-pen set function instead of trying to invent a local implementation
|
|
|
|
|
r34421
| file changeset diff or repo changeset diff
| igor2 | 2021-04-12T10:00:07.966393Z
| [core] -Cleanup: remove pcb_custom_route_style - not used by anything, not reentrant; leftover from a pre-conf time
|
|
|
|
r34412
| file changeset diff or repo changeset diff
| igor2 | 2021-04-12T08:04:57.553223Z
| [core] -Add: pcb_route_style_lookup() and pcb_route_style_match(): take text scale, text thickness, text font ID and padstack via prototype for full matching
|
|
|
|
|
|
r34323
| file changeset diff or repo changeset diff
| igor2 | 2021-04-08T09:40:28.459849Z
| [core] -Cleanup: pcb_board_set_via_size() shouldn't check for hardwired minimal/maximal via size (it was overridden by force anyway)
|
|
r34322
| file changeset diff or repo changeset diff
| igor2 | 2021-04-08T09:35:45.099271Z
| [core] -Cleanup: pcb_board_set_via_drilling_hole() shouldn't check for code hardwired minimal/maximal hole size (it was overriden using force anyway)
|
|
|
|
|
|
r32971
| file changeset diff or repo changeset diff
| igor2 | 2020-10-03T13:55:22.222896Z
| [core] -Fix: remove PCB dependency in some crosshair code that may run in New() [core] -Fix: New() does set PCB when it is created
|
|
|
r32905
| file changeset diff or repo changeset diff
| igor2 | 2020-10-02T07:50:17.924276Z
| [core] -Add: prepare the crosshair code to be able to build a cache for atatched object drawing: publish a clean() function that needs to be called before any crosshair attached object change so a cache can be maintained
|
|
|
|
|
|
|
|
|
|
r32709
| file changeset diff or repo changeset diff
| igor2 | 2020-09-14T10:02:04.479563Z
| [core] -Cleanup: decouple pcb_board_set_changed_flag() from PCB, adding a pcb_board_t * context pointer first arg
|
|
|
|
r32115
| file changeset diff or repo changeset diff
| igor2 | 2020-07-02T06:53:03.201898Z
| [core] -Cleanup: rename attrib.[ch] public symbols back to pcb_ prefix from rnd_ prefix as they are not part of librnd anymore
|
|
r32113
| file changeset diff or repo changeset diff
| igor2 | 2020-07-02T06:24:58.617299Z
| [librnd] -Cleanup: move attrib.[ch] out, back to pcb-rnd core - it's pcb-rnd specific code that got in the hidlib only because of the old custom per hid attribute dialog implementations
|
|
r31824
| file changeset diff or repo changeset diff
| igor2 | 2020-06-09T09:57:10.118055Z
| [core] -Fix: grid realign should use crosshair coords, not mosue cursor coords, but grid size is still set to 0;0 - this allows both picking the alignment to a "background image" and realign to an object
|
|
r31800
| file changeset diff or repo changeset diff
| igor2 | 2020-06-06T08:57:28.318288Z
| [core] -Fix: RouteStyle() set generates the necessary route-style-changed event and if we were setting the current style, updates the pen too, so the current style stays selected
|
|
r31797
| file changeset diff or repo changeset diff
| igor2 | 2020-06-06T07:35:51.778790Z
| [core] -Add: RouteStyle() accepts "@current" as first argument for working with the current style (useful for set and get)
|
|
|
|
|
|
r31603
| file changeset diff or repo changeset diff
| igor2 | 2020-05-26T13:03:30.212843Z
| [core] -Fix: realign grid broke long ago - it needs to ask for the coordinate locally and set the grid to something fine before
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
r29923
| file changeset diff or repo changeset diff
| igor2 | 2020-03-01T09:58:45.625386Z
| [core] -Add: {v n} on subc toggles a hidden internal flag; when the flag is set, any terminal name change will turn on name visibility on the subc-part object
|
|
|
r29851
| file changeset diff or repo changeset diff
| igor2 | 2020-02-17T07:39:25.233438Z
| [librnd] -Move: grid related actions from core to librnd because menu files of other apps will also depend on it
|
|
|
|